Transaction 10958b63caffa08d777cf14c6365a7845170e892092b9e5c94e86304138cffa7
1 Input
1 Output
-
10958b63caffa08d777cf14c6365a7845170e892092b9e5c94e86304138cffa7:0
- value
- 20996
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 22edb4ac3ad006df8e227d7d1a8679a787406ee29211a1e65370dc70472c8db8
- address
- bc1pytkmftp66qrdlr3z04734pne57r5qmhzjgg6rejnwrw8q3ev3kuqa8qdtm